๐Ÿ“ธ Tรผrkiye showcases its TAYFUN Block 4 hypersonic ballistic missile at SAHA 2026 in Istanbul.

Developed by ROKETSAN, this is the largest and most powerful version of the TAYFUN family, and Tรผrkiyeโ€™s longest-range domestic ballistic missile (range undisclosed).

โ€ข Length: ~10 m
โ€ข Weight: ~7.2 tons
โ€ข Speed: Mach 5+ (hypersonic)

First unveiled at IDEF 2025, now displayed on its 8x8 launcher at SAHA.

Dr. Andreas Krieg | Gulf Security Expert | Institute of Middle Eastern Studies:
 
Since October 7th, the UAE's PR has been on a downhill slope. Qatar & Saudi Arabia have become dominant in the information domain themselves - the Emirates are no longer on their own.
 
The UAE is no longer seen as advancing stability. Arming non-state actors & secessionists - most visibly in Sudan - has made them a cause of instability. The atrocities in Sudan were a tipping point.
 
But rather than backing down, Abu Dhabi doubles down. That's their strategic culture - push through pressure rather than apologize.
 
Saudi Arabia has shown a learning curve. Qatar has changed under pressure. The UAE hasn't.
 
They're digging a deeper hole - an echo chamber where Abu Dhabi insists everyone else is wrong, despite most Arabs, Muslims & Western governments.
 
The narrative now coming out of Abu Dhabi is "we're different, we don't need anyone."
 
That "us against the world" mentality is very similar to Netanyahu's Israel today.

Israel is coordinating with the U.S. as rising tensions in the Strait of Hormuz threaten the Iran ceasefire, according to an Israeli source.

Plans are in place for a short, targeted campaignโ€”possibly striking Iranโ€™s energy infrastructure and senior officialsโ€”to pressure Tehran in negotiations.

The final decision depends on Trump, who is frustrated with stalled talks but hesitant to escalate into full-scale war.

Source: CNN

๐Ÿฅท Tรผrkiyeโ€™s Ninja Missile

๐Ÿ“ธ ROKETSAN unveils NeลŸter smart gliding munition at SAHA 2026 in Istanbul.

โ€” A variant of the MAM-L, it minimizes collateral damage by using a proximity sensor and a unique warhead with deployable cutting blades that activate just before impact.

โ€” Instead of using explosives, it neutralizes targets through direct, high-precision kinetic action, making it suitable for pinpoint strikes rather than area destruction.
